Transaction 8080dbbf003de37512ee5f51618e8f65f54a832ea2f803a85692eee62b5fe213
3 Input
1 Outputs
- 8080dbbf003de37512ee5f51618e8f65f54a832ea2f803a85692eee62b5fe213:0
value 1772036
address bc1q0zmpqvagpcrfhvrvyq46skuyxwvtzwsesj29mz